What is white distilled vinegar?

White distilled vinegar is made through a process called fermentation. Grains like corn, wheat, or rice are first mixed with water and yeast to convert their starches into sugar. Next, the sugar is fermented into alcohol, and finally, bacteria are added to the alcohol to turn it into acetic acid. The resulting liquid is a clear, acidic, and tangy vinegar that is widely used in Cooking, pickling, and as a Cleaning agent. Its acidity makes it a useful household cleaner, while its tangy flavor makes it a popular condiment in many dishes.

Are there any side effects of consuming white distilled vinegar?

Consuming White distilled vinegar in moderate amounts is generally safe for most people. However, consuming large amounts of vinegar can cause digestive issues like nausea, indigestion, and diarrhea. Additionally, its high acidity can damage tooth enamel and irritate the skin if applied topically.

4. Is white distilled vinegar gluten-free?

Yes! White distilled vinegar is made by fermenting grains such as corn or wheat, but the final product does not contain any gluten. Therefore, it is safe for people with celiac disease or gluten intolerance to consume.

5. Can white distilled vinegar be used as a food preservative?

Yes! White distilled vinegar has long been used as a natural food preservative. It helps prevent the growth of harmful bacteria and fungi, which can cause food spoilage and pose health risks. Vinegar is often added to pickles, sauces, and marinades as a natural way to prolong their shelf life.
